The Hoosier Works EBT card is light blue, with gold and dark blue lettering. It has a unique 16-digit account number, a magnetic strip on the back, and will only work with a four-digit Personal Identification Number. EBT is easy, convenient and secure. Mary Swinford …First Steps is Indiana's early intervention program that provides services to infants and toddlers from birth to third birthday who have developmental delays or disabilities. First Steps brings families together with a local network of professionals from education, health and social service agencies. There are three eligibility tests for SNAP: the Gross Income, the Net Income, and the Asset tests. Many disabled people feel that they may be able to return to work, but are fearful of losing their Medicaid benefits. MED Works is a program designed to allow disabled employees to work without fear of losing their Medicaid.
